What is the purpose of the fuel vent system in the aircraft?

Explanation:
The fuel vent system is meant to keep the fuel tanks from building up pressure as temperatures change and fuel expands. By allowing air and fuel vapors to escape to the atmosphere, the tanks stay at ambient pressure rather than becoming pressurized. That’s why describing its purpose as unpressurized fits: the system’s job is to prevent pressurization, not to pressurize or seal the tanks.
